Abstract

According to an exemplary embodiment of the present invention, a terminal and a method for controlling an audio output path is provided. The terminal includes: an audio output path setting unit to determine an audio output path for one or more audio data when one or more audio event occurs; an audio output unit to output a first audio data in a first audio output path; and a data communication unit to transmit one or more audio data other than the first audio data to external terminal(s) by setting a second audio output path.

Claims (35)

1. A source terminal to control an audio output path, the source terminal comprising:

a processor configured with processor-executable instructions to:

execute events comprising audio data;

acquire a first audio data and a second audio data, the first audio data being different from the second audio data;

select a first terminal and a second terminal from the source terminal and one or more sink terminals connected to the source terminal to simultaneously output the first audio data and the second audio data, respectively; and

set a first audio output path to output the first audio data and a second audio output path to output the second audio data,

wherein the first audio data is delivered in the first audio output path to the first terminal, and the second audio data is delivered in the second audio output path to the second terminal, and

wherein the first audio output path and the second audio output path are set based on audio output information comprising a type of an audio codec of the source terminal and the one or more sink terminals and a priority level.
